Working Garden Day at the Chateau

Join one of the working days at the Chateau.

Yes to be frankly honest we are charging you to come and work! These ‘Garden’ days are an opportunity to come and visit us at the Chateau. There will be an abundance of food and drink, and we will be on hand to answer any questions. In return you have to help make the place beautiful! Sadly we are unable to take children or pets on ‘work’ days. The garden and grounds are still a bit of a blank canvas so all good suggestions gratefully received! There is a degree of manual work expected although some jobs will be gentler than others, and no matter what the weather, we will be outside working, so please dress appropriately.

Team Building and Senior Management Strategy Retreats

Chateau-de-la-Motte Husson provides the perfect location for groups to get together for team building or for senior management to meet in an informal environment to address strategy or business issues.

Dick Strawbridge will facilitate and host the visit. With twenty years of military experience, including a wide variety of roles from leading scientists in support of counter-terrorism to managing projects for the MOD Procurement Executive, a successful career as a programme manager and trouble-shooter for a multinational company, and his more recent escapades in the media, he has a truly diverse knowledge of management and leadership.

 

Packages are customised to the requirements of the client, and Dick and Angel have the facilities to provide everything from outdoor challenges to boardroom discussions, all set in the beautiful chateau and with the highest standard of hosting, food and refreshment.

A French Food Lovers’ Weekend

Husband and wife Dick Strawbridge and Angel Adoree invite you to spend an intimate (three couple’s per weekend) French Food Lovers experience in their home, Chateau-de-la-Motte Husson.

Set in fairytale surroundings within the Pays de la Loire, France, the Chateau-de-la-Motte Husson sits proudly on the site of an ancient fort, surrounded by twelve acres of stunning parkland.

Compared to the rest of France, three times as many people of Mayenne work the land, and local produce abounds in the markets. Many of the stallholders are locals, selling their surplus harvest.

Dick Strawbridge has always enjoyed growing and rearing his own food, so his move to France was home from home. After becoming a finalist in Celebrity Masterchef, Dick’s love for food became apparent to the nation, and when he met Angel Adoree, founder of The Vintage Patisserie and author of three vintage cook-books, their life became one big food lovers adventure.

Dick and Angel often talked about their dream weekend and what it would entail.  Having moved to France, they are now in the position to host a fabulous feast of delicious food and great wine; a celebration of their French country life.
